In a side plot, Audrey Hope struggles with her mother’s alcoholism and financial instability, leading her to seek comfort in a tryst with Max Wolfe , complicating her relationship with Aki Menzies . Max, meanwhile, continues his pursuit of their teacher, Rafa Caparros , using Aki as a pawn in his games. In the second episode of the reboot, titled "She's Having a Maybe," the tension between half-sisters Julien Calloway and Zoya Lott reaches a breaking point as they navigate the social landmines of the Upper East Side. Plot Summary
The episode centers on the fallout from the pilot's events, with scrambling to manage her social media image while Zoya begins a tentative romance with Julien's ex, Obie Bergmann IV .
